Output fa0cb57d6ec5a256c3c644c13900e0b0dc98d6186c53a0d0ba22166b89fa8c67:0

value
14513419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d7ded14dd33ab61072ff4a9d01e12db3377c50e OP_EQUAL
address
3BfxRxAytd3dVk6Qf7csQzfKBQFYTjGyHv
transaction
fa0cb57d6ec5a256c3c644c13900e0b0dc98d6186c53a0d0ba22166b89fa8c67
confirmations
420479
spent
true